148 listings
$ 44,845
NEW
Ephrata, PA
$ 45,266
100 miles
$ 45,235
$ 25,885
$ 45,503
$ 19,995
61,741 miles
$ 33,989
91,887 miles
$ 19,498
84,010 miles
$ 44,481
$ 45,055
$ 42,799
71,950 miles
$ 7,495
118,803 miles
$ 45,952
$ 34,995
28,236 miles
$ 24,496
$ 42,256
$ 39,985
$ 61,247
$ 42,898
25,438 miles
$ 40,485
$ 16,995
126,917 miles
$ 40,985
$ 35,804
36,789 miles
$ 62,562